资讯
配置VS Code 开发STM32【宇宙&最强编辑器】(2023-03-23)
文件C:OpenOCDshareopenocdscripts文件夹中可以找到
配置文件路径
4.使用任务进行编译和下载
a.编译工程:按Ctrl+Shift+P,搜索task任务配置,选择配置任务,然后选择C/C......
CLion配置STM32开发环境(2023-03-23)
先点击取消,我们后面再来说。
选择下载文件
CLion中,这三个图标分别为编译、下载和调试
点击绿色的小锤子,则可以编译整个工程
如果有新增加的C/C++文件,则需......
方舟编译器应用于华为手机上,有哪些性能优势?(2023-10-01)
,华为方舟编译器所拥有的全新的应用编译和运行机制,能够从动态编译变为静态编译,直接将高级语言直接编译成机器码,彻底消除了虚拟机动态编译的额外开销,实现了开发和运行效率的兼容并举,所以方舟编译......
keil c51是如何启动c程序的(2023-06-25)
keil c51是如何启动c程序的;汇编是从org 0000h开始启动,那么keil c51是如何启动main()函数的?keil c51有一个启动程序startup.a51,它总是和c程序一起编译和......
别用keil了,CLion同样可以用于STM32开发(2023-04-07)
友肯定会被它强大的代码补全、界面风格、各种插件、流畅性等众多优点所吸引,毫无疑问这些是能够极大提高开发效率的。而其中有一款CLion IDE就是专门面向C/C++开发的,所以本篇文章会介绍如何把STM32的编译......
当前STM32几种最流行的开发环境对比(2023-03-14)
方便使用寄存器开发模式的开发者。虽然没有KEIL那种离线仿真能力,但不影响使用,真实的开发环境下几乎没人会用到那个功能。
STM32CubeIDE总体评价 84分
CLion
CLion是大名鼎鼎的JetBrains推出的C......
开源嵌入式编译器,没想象中那么好?(2024-09-09)
计算机产业也都处于拓荒的年代,所以就涌现了很多款C语言编译器。
根据EEWorld的调研,嵌入式工程师比较青睐的嵌入式编译器主要包括Keil(ArmCC)、IAR、GCC、AVR GCC、CLion、Clang......
STM32通过命令行编译和下载keil和IAR工程的方法(2024-09-20)
',前提是在IAR下面都配置好了,并且成功下载过一次的工程。
--download_only
4、使用方法
我们可以在工程所在的路径下面编写bat文件,通过直接运行bat就可以编译和下载了,第三方编辑器通常都可以配置编译......
S3C2440⑤ | S3C2440时钟体系架构及实验(2024-07-15)
int *)0x56000054 |= (1<<4);
delay(100000);
}
}
编译的makefile也和之前相同;
2.3.运行结果
第一......
GCC编译器原理(三)------编译原理三:编译过程(2-1)---编译之词法分析(2024-08-22)
)
(字符)+(数字)*(字符)*(数字)*
Lex 编程可以分为三步:
以 Lex 可以理解的格式指定模式相关的动作。
在这一文件上运行 Lex,生成扫描器的 C 代码。
编译和链接 C 代码......
合见工软发布灵活适配的高性能仿真器UniVista Simulator(2021-10-12)
(简称UVS)。UVS是一款商用级别的高效数字验证仿真引擎,拥有自主知识产权,采用了先进的编译和性能提升技术来优化编译时间和运行速度,为各种类型的客户设计提供了高效可靠的数字验证仿真。该产......
Sqlite移植到mini2440(2024-06-27)
安装后目标存放的目录,你可以任意设置
4.执行make和make install命令,如下: make make install 编译和安装完后,在/root/sqlite......
多功能STM32开发工具STM32CubeIDE使用指南(2024-07-23)
了CM7和CM4这两个“子”工程。AN5361,AN5394,AN5360和AN5564分别描述了在STM32CubeIDE中如何创建,导入,编译和调试STM32H7双核,STM32L5......
Android + Mini2440 无线网络视频监控系统 SQLite的移植(2024-06-21)
入该目录,用于在这个目录中进行交叉编译,如下: # mkdir build # cd build
3.在build目录中运行sqlite-autoconf-3070701中的configure......
mini2440上移植sqlite3.7.6.2(2024-06-28)
cd sqlite-3.6.22
2. 创建一个目录 build 并进入该目录,用于在这个目录中进行交叉编译,如下:
mkdir build
cd build
3. 在 build 目录中运行......
STM32单片机编程方式及工作原理(2023-07-03)
开发者可以方便地进行编程、编译和调试。
STM32CubeIDE:STM32CubeIDE是STMicroelectronics提供的官方集成开发环境,可以使用C/C++语言编程,支持多种STM32单片机系列,提供......
怎样在Linux上开发STM32程序(2024-02-27)
接位于本教程的第一步,并且在我的所有youtube视频下。里面是空的main.c文件,以及此处理器和Makefile的一些启动文件。 Makefile可以告诉C编译器在哪里找到arm编译器,如何编译......
使用ESP8266模块制作热水器控制器(2023-06-19)
ESP8266源代码
上一步生成的源代码是运行在ESP8266模块内部的,怎么编译和烧写呢?
下面这个文档有说明:
https://dwz.date/fpVy
关于开发环境搭建的内容:
关于......
VScode + keil开发环境搭建安装使用过程(2023-03-28)
干!
Keil Assistant
插件安装与使用
其实在Vscode上就有专门的插件可以调用keil的接口去实现编译和下载 - Keil Assistant,这个插件只是调用keil的api,实际上代码的编译和......
Mini2440移植qt-extended4.4.3(2024-06-21)
件系统:root_qtopia(嵌入式家园提供)
声明:bootloader、内核和根文件系统大家也可以直接使用友善之臂提供的。
二、交叉编译tslib1.4
编译和运行qt-extended-4.4.3......
以s3c2440为例讲解arm芯片的启动过程(2023-01-03)
真正了解这一启动过程必须要首先了解存储器的区别与联系,参考文章:各种主流半导体存储器的区别与联系。还需要了解程序是如何编译链接和执行的。
本文将以s3c2440为例详细讲述 arm 芯片的启动过程。s3c2440支持两种启动模式:NAND......
以s3c2440为例的arm芯片的启动过程(2023-01-09)
真正了解这一启动过程必须要首先了解存储器的区别与联系,参考文章:各种主流半导体存储器的区别与联系。还需要了解程序是如何编译链接和执行的。
本文将以s3c2440为例详细讲述 arm 芯片的启动过程。s3c2440支持两种启动模式:NAND......
MBDT实现电机控制设计(2024-07-31)
例工程BLDC_ClosedLoop_s32k144.mdl为例,展示如何利用MBDT生成并运行电机控制算法,使用到的硬件是 MCSPTE1AK144 。
找到示例模型BLDC_ClosedLoop_s32k144.mdl的目......
S3C2440硬件编程实例(2024-06-11)
:
B MAIN_LOOP
使用如下命令进行编译和连接:
arm-linux-gcc -g -c -o led_on.o led_on.Sarm......
安全编码技术:提高嵌入式应用代码安全性与可靠性(2024-08-27)
实施安全编码技术并遵循所有这些规则呢?
使用自动化工具
提高软件质量、安全性和可靠性的最佳方法是使用自动化工具。这可以通过使用高质量的编译器和链接器(最好是经过功能安全认证的编译器和链接器),以及自动化的静态分析和运行......
安全编码技术:提高嵌入式应用代码安全性与可靠性(2024-08-27)
缝集成了静态分析工具 C-STAT和运行时分析工具C-RUN,形成了完整的工具链。凭借这些强大的功能,IAR Embedded Workbench可以确保代码的稳健性、安全性和高质量。
我们先来看看编译......
51单片机编程环境的搭建及代码编写的方法(2024-03-20)
软仿真是能够看到Keil编译后的汇编代码,单步调试可以跟踪各个寄存器的状态变化,但是软仿真是无法得到真实的外部输入状态的,如仿真真实开发板的按键输入等。代码调试时往往需要知道编译器是否按照要求进行代码的编译处理,因此,可以让编译器输出它是如何编译......
uboot的简单易懂的启动流程(2023-06-07)
include/config 文件夹里面出现一个此平台的设置文件 可以剪裁此uboot 然后执行make all 会进行编译和连接。 2. 完成1 之后 请看CPU文件夹下面的start.S 这个......
uboot的简单易懂的启动流程(参照韦东山的讲义)(2023-09-05)
会在include/config 文件夹里面出现一个此平台的设置文件 可以剪裁此uboot 然后执行make all 会进行编译和连接。
2. 完成1 之后 请看CPU文件夹下面的start.S......
MCU厂商,都在重视IDE(2024-06-16)
、C166、C251,其中MDK分为社区版和商用版,Keil简单易用、功能强大,编译速度在大型项目上具备优势,编出来的代码大小较小且运行更为安全,而且官方出品兼容性最好,备受开发者青睐。
IAR......
分析嵌入式软件代码的漏洞 —— 代码注入(2023-12-28)
格式字符串后跟一个其他参数的列表,并且该格式字符串被解释为一组指令,用于将剩余的参数呈现为字符串。
大多数用户知道如何编写最常用的格式说明符:例如字符串,整数和浮点数——%s,%d,%f,但是......
云维保专家推荐:生产设备的点检标准该如何编制?(2023-05-11)
云维保专家推荐:生产设备的点检标准该如何编制?;现代化生产设备日益向高度自动化、密集型生产方向发展,设备一旦发生故障就会全面停机,影响整个产线的生产,排产计划的延误,将给企业带来严重经济损失。所以......
米尔Remi Pi到货,再添面向工业产品的软件系统(2024-03-14)
04_Sources目录下获取lvgl.tar.bz2源码包,解压源码包。
PC:~/renesas/04_Sources$ tar -xvf lvgl.tar.gz
编译源码包,拷贝lvgl_demo可执行文件到开发板运行......
uboot启动后在内存中运行裸机程序hello(2023-09-06)
到何处。修改完后重新编译uboot.bin。
在DNW下执行dnw 50008000 USB下载uboot.bin到内存50008000处, go 50008000,从内存50008000处运行......
意法半导体的STM32F429微控制器上的一个μClinux项目实现(2024-06-04)
库选择:
●glibc是开源GNU项目提供的可用C函数库。该库是全功能、可移植的,它符合Linux标准。
●嵌入式GLIBC(EGLIBC)是一款针对嵌入式系统优化的衍生版。其代码是精简的,支持交叉编译和......
基于测试管理环境TestStand的测试系统的应用设计(2023-06-02)
有主流测试编程环境兼容,如NI LabVIEW,LabWindows/CVI,NI Measurement Studio组件,微软Visual Basic和Visual C++等,TestStand能调用任何编译......
ADS1.2中RO base与RW base(2023-09-06)
后是ZI类型数据。
(3); C中的已被初始化成非0值的变量编译后市RW类型数据。
4。加载时地址:是映象文件位于存储器(还没有运行,一般在ROM中)时的地址
5。运行时地址:是映象文件运行......
ARM嵌入式编译器(五) 优化循环的4种方法(2022-12-09)
效。
编译指示的相关用法:
注:虽然给出了循环展开的编译指示,但Arm官方不建议使用,这样会影响编译器的展开优化和其他循环优化。
将代码分别复制到file.c文件中,然后使用以下命令进行编译和......
STM32MP135开发板助力电力行业,IEC61850协议移植笔记(2024-06-21)
配置环境
本章节讲述libIEC61850库的编译环境配置过程。
2.1.安装JAVA环境
IEC61850库中的ICD文件需要一个JAVA工具来进行转换,所以需要先安装JAVA运行环境。米尔提供的JDK......
单片机开发中的C语言技巧(上)(2023-01-09)
单片机开发中的C语言技巧(上);1、简介
市面上介绍C语言以及编程方法的书数目繁多,但对如何编写优质嵌入式C程序却鲜有介绍,特别是对应用于单片机、ARM7、Cortex-M3这类微控制器上的优质C......
关于ARM7 S3C4510B上μClinux移植问题(2022-12-26)
.rpm
配置目标为arm的GNU的C编译器。使用他在宿主机上开发编译目标上可运行的二进制文件。
(3)genromfs0.5.11.i386.rpm
生成Romfs的工具。Romfs是一......
一文解析STM32启动流程(2024-02-03)
-data 的区别是程序刚运行时这些数据初始值全都为 0,而后续运行过程与 RW-data 的性质一样,它们也常驻在 RAM 区,因而应用程序可以更改其内容。例如 C 语言中使用定义的全局变量,且定......
STM32CubeIDE入门教程 STM32CubeIDE安装使用教程(2024-07-17)
生成,代码编译和调试功能。它基于Eclipse®/ CDT框架和GCC工具链进行开发,并基于GDB进行调试。它允许现有几百插件是完成了Eclipse的功能整合®IDE。STM32CubeIDE集成......
基于嵌入式系统的以太网控制器设计(2023-02-06)
骤:建立μCLinux 操作系统的交叉编译环境、μCLinux 操作系统的编译和μCLinux 操作系统的加载。
2.3 RTL8019AS 驱动程序
设备......
了从产品开发到大规模生产的每个步骤都具备强大的安全防护。”
IAR Embedded Workbench for Arm作为一个完整的开发工具链,包含高度优化的编译器和强大的调试器功能。开发者可以利用C-STAT和C-RUN等代......
记录Ok6410 sd 启动uboot(2024-09-27)
SD卡启动流程,那么如何编译烧写用的mmc.bin文件呢,在uboot1.1.6/include/configs/smdk6410.h文件里有相关的宏定义:
可见......
蜂鸣器类代码(2024-08-15)
写为ifndef,c语言在对程序进行
编译时,会先根据预处理命令进行“预处理”。C语言
编译系统包括预处理,编译和链接等部分。
*/
#ifndef _BEEP1_H_ //先测......
STM32单片机程序是如何编译,运行的?(2024-08-26)
STM32单片机程序是如何编译,运行的?;不知道大家有没有疑惑,为什么软件能控制硬件? 本文分析STM32单片机到底是如何软硬件结合的,分析单片机程序如何编译,运行。
一、软硬件结合
初学......
基于MPC5744P的MACL和EB的开发编译和配置(2023-05-24)
基于MPC5744P的MACL和EB的开发编译和配置;摘要
本篇笔记主要记录基于MPC5744P的MACL和EB的开发编译和配置。
准备工作
准备好一个在EB下配置好的工程,这里......
使用硬件I2C读取温湿度传感器数据(HTS221)(2023-04-24)
小封装:
HTS221实物图
HTS221的原理图如下:
HTS221原理图
软件准备
需要安装好Keil - MDK及芯片对应的包,以便编译和下载生成的代码;
准备一个串口调试助手,这里......
相关企业
;电子设备和运行管理;;
国德克萨斯的Keil Software Inc。Keil公司制造和销售种类广泛的开发工具,包括ANSI C编译器、宏汇编程序、调试器、连接器、库管理器、固件和实时操作系统核心(real-time kernel
;济南科技发展公司;;编译器
;深圳市锐垒科技有限公司;;深圳市锐垒科技有限公司是一家继电器、开关、连接器、IC、Clion、Tyco、Nais、Omron等产品的经销批发的个体经营。深圳市锐垒科技有限公司经营的继电器、开关
;C&C Technolgy Co., ltd;;Microsoft VBScript 运行时错误 错误 '800a005e' 无效使用 Null: 'replace' /usersinfo
;art科技有限公司;;提供专业的数据采集方案,主营数据采集卡PCI/USB/PXI/PC104,RS485采集模块,嵌入式主板,GPRS和RTU,信号调理模块 软件支持: VC 、VB、C
、schrack、P&B、finder 、tyco、clion…分销商。并以优质的服务取得客户的一致好评
;广东叶丰盈有限公司;;电脑E族www.netezu.com关注电脑族的健康,致力于为电脑一族提供健康资讯,健康常识。久坐电脑前,久坐办公室,电脑族,办公室一族如何护眼,如何保护眼睛、保护视力,如何
滨世纪语通翻译公司是中国最大翻译连锁机构,汇集全国优秀的翻译资源,翻译语言多达70余种,服务范围涵盖40多个行业、各个领域。全面支持中外交替笔译、口译和同声传译。高效、准确、平价,是我们的目标,您的满意就是我们最大的满足。
升级。
2011年3月15日 - RPM系统公司的YouTube频道现在是启动和运行。它提供了如何对各种产品的产品演示视频.
3月8日,2011 - RPM系统很高兴地宣布Facebook上我